Gevrey-Chambertin Aux Combottes 2005 from Hubert Lignier is a Premier Cru red from Gevrey-Chambertin. This vineyard is uniquely situated, surrounded on three sides by Grand Cru sites, which is reflected in the wine’s structural gravity and depth. The 2005 release offers a massive fruit core of black cherries and plums, supported by firm tannins and a persistent mineral line. Following the estate’s traditionalist approach, the wine underwent a long maturation in French oak, adding layers of sweet spice and cedar. After two decades, the tannins are beginning to resolve, revealing complex tertiary notes of leather, truffle and game.
